Grants paid by Bert N Mitchell Family Foundation C/O Robbin Mitchell, tax year 2022

EIN 13-3617553 · New York, NY · Form 990-PF, Part XV

In tax year 2022, Bert N Mitchell Family Foundation C/O Robbin Mitchell (EIN 13-3617553) reported 6 grants paid totaling $45,000.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
